Skip site navigation (1)Skip section navigation (2)
Date:      Tue, 25 Jan 2022 16:37:14 GMT
From:      Ashish SHUKLA <ashish@FreeBSD.org>
To:        ports-committers@FreeBSD.org, dev-commits-ports-all@FreeBSD.org, dev-commits-ports-branches@FreeBSD.org
Subject:   git: 629197586cda - 2022Q1 - net-im/py-matrix-synapse: Unbreak the port
Message-ID:  <202201251637.20PGbEYO048260@gitrepo.freebsd.org>

next in thread | raw e-mail | index | archive | help
The branch 2022Q1 has been updated by ashish:

URL: https://cgit.FreeBSD.org/ports/commit/?id=629197586cda1f5f9b5ae670605a93b03767a962

commit 629197586cda1f5f9b5ae670605a93b03767a962
Author:     Sascha Biberhofer <ports@skyforge.at>
AuthorDate: 2022-01-18 17:37:18 +0000
Commit:     Ashish SHUKLA <ashish@FreeBSD.org>
CommitDate: 2022-01-25 16:35:37 +0000

    net-im/py-matrix-synapse: Unbreak the port
    
    - Remove the dependency constraint added by upstream for problem
      on Debian GNU/Linux, which does not occur on FreeBSD
    
    This commit resolves a merge conflict due to skipping 0290f284f.
    
    PR:             261232
    (cherry picked from commit e51b5b86095bdb962b05f3c1e504fb33a91d5c96)
---
 net-im/py-matrix-synapse/Makefile                           |  1 +
 .../files/patch-synapse_python__dependencies.py             | 13 +++++++++++--
 2 files changed, 12 insertions(+), 2 deletions(-)

diff --git a/net-im/py-matrix-synapse/Makefile b/net-im/py-matrix-synapse/Makefile
index e28b239c4b16..f16b9ac29219 100644
--- a/net-im/py-matrix-synapse/Makefile
+++ b/net-im/py-matrix-synapse/Makefile
@@ -3,6 +3,7 @@
 PORTNAME=	matrix-synapse
 DISTVERSIONPREFIX=	v
 DISTVERSION=	1.49.2
+PORTREVISION=	2
 CATEGORIES=	net-im python
 PKGNAMEPREFIX=	${PYTHON_PKGNAMEPREFIX}
 
diff --git a/net-im/py-matrix-synapse/files/patch-synapse_python__dependencies.py b/net-im/py-matrix-synapse/files/patch-synapse_python__dependencies.py
index 4b3041fc7432..808f68974615 100644
--- a/net-im/py-matrix-synapse/files/patch-synapse_python__dependencies.py
+++ b/net-im/py-matrix-synapse/files/patch-synapse_python__dependencies.py
@@ -1,6 +1,15 @@
---- synapse/python_dependencies.py.orig	2021-12-17 15:03:44 UTC
+--- synapse/python_dependencies.py.orig	2022-01-15 14:42:17 UTC
 +++ synapse/python_dependencies.py
-@@ -85,7 +85,7 @@ REQUIREMENTS = [
+@@ -51,7 +51,7 @@ REQUIREMENTS = [
+     # we use the TYPE_CHECKER.redefine method added in jsonschema 3.0.0
+     "jsonschema>=3.0.0",
+     # frozendict 2.1.2 is broken on Debian 10: https://github.com/Marco-Sulla/python-frozendict/issues/41
+-    "frozendict>=1,<2.1.2",
++    "frozendict>=1",
+     "unpaddedbase64>=1.1.0",
+     "canonicaljson>=1.4.0",
+     # we use the type definitions added in signedjson 1.1.
+@@ -86,7 +86,7 @@ REQUIREMENTS = [
      "typing-extensions>=3.7.4",
      # We enforce that we have a `cryptography` version that bundles an `openssl`
      # with the latest security patches.



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?202201251637.20PGbEYO048260>